What's The Definition Of Pudendum?
[n] human external genital organs collectively especially of a female
Synonyms | Synonyms for Pudendum: Related Terms | Find terms related to Pudendum: See Also | crotch | genital organ | genitalia | genitals | private parts | privates Pudendum In Webster's Dictionary \Pu*den"dum\, n. [NL. See {Pudenda}.] (Anat.)
The external organs of generation, especially of the female;
the vulva.
